When and where is the Europa League final?

Báo Lạng SơnBáo Lạng Sơn30/05/2023


This season's Europa League final will take place at 2:00 a.m. on June 1 (Vietnam time) at the Puskás Aréna in Budapest, Hungary. This is a 65,000-seat stadium, named in honor of former Real Madrid striker Ferenc Puskás.

Notably, this is the second UEFA final to be held at Puskás Stadium. Previously, Puskás Stadium hosted the 2020 UEFA Super Cup, when Bayern Munich defeated Sevilla 2-1.

Competition format

The Europa League final follows the same format as the UEFA Champions League final. The two teams play a single leg of the match. In the event of a draw after 90 minutes, the match goes into two 15-minute extra periods. The team that scores more goals wins.

If the scores are still level after extra time, the Europa League title will be decided by a nerve-wracking penalty shootout.

Some highlights

– AS Roma coach Jose Mourinho has won five major European titles to date, including the UEFA Cup in 2003, the UEFA Champions League in 2004 and 2010, the UEFA Europa League in 2017 and the UEFA Europa Conference League in 2022. If AS Roma lifts the UEFA Europa League trophy this season, the “special one” will be the coach with the most championships in the history of major European tournaments, surpassing Italian coach Giovanni Trapattoni (5 times).

– Sevilla is known as the “king of Europa League” as they have won this tournament 6 times and have never lost a Europa League final in the past.

– Sevilla and AS Roma have only met in Europe in the round of 16 of the 2019-20 Europa League, where the Spanish side won 2-0 and it was also the last time Sevilla won the tournament.
